dead navigation screen
My navigation screen is blank and won't work and also the temperature section near the speedometer is also blank. Has anyone had this type of problem before? The only thing I added was the shock sensor to the factory alarm. The navigation was working when I was finished, so I don't know if that would be the cause. I added the shock sensor over a month ago.
just goto your local dealer...i had this problem too...it would either freeze or just not come on at all...so I took it to Park Ave Acura and they gave me a new screen....
Now I'm having problems again with the new screen..20K miles later...It seems like a connection is loose or something...b/c everytime i hit a bump hard or something..the screen would turn yellow...
